Output 9050efed2a39d7e06c7c6d0403ea6184cd4a8f979ed756d43e9723cc90aceebf:61

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 607e24cbbb81bad20da093d3952a67049bd19a8f02475871408fed6b50fc072e
address
bc1pvplzfjamsxadyrdqj0fe22n8qjdarx50qfr4su2q3lkkk58uquhquc048g
transaction
9050efed2a39d7e06c7c6d0403ea6184cd4a8f979ed756d43e9723cc90aceebf